For shopping near the Royal Botanic Gardens, visit Martin Place, a vibrant shopping mall just 644m away. The Rocks Markets, 1.3km away, offers a unique public market experience. If you're up for a drive, check out Oxford Street, located 3.2km away, for more city vibes.

Recreation

The Sydney Cricket Ground, 3.2km from the Royal Botanic Gardens, offers a vibrant sports atmosphere perfect for fitness enthusiasts. Enjoy live music at the Metro Theatre, 1.4km away, or relax at Bondi Icebergs pool, 6.4km away, ideal for family-friendly outdoor activities.

Adventure

The Bondi to Bronte Coastal Walk offers breathtaking views and invigorating hikes, located 6.4km from the Royal Botanic Gardens. For a fun family activity, explore the McElhone Stairs, situated 483m away. If you're into underwater sports, head to Ben Buckler Point, also 6.4km distant.

Best time to go to Royal Botanic Gardens

The best time to visit Royal Botanic Gardens can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Royal Botanic Gardens falls in January,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Royal Botanic Gardens falls in July,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January73.4°F (23.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February72.7°F (22.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
March70.9°F (21.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
April66.4°F (19.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May61.2°F (16.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
July55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
August57.2°F (14.0°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
September61.2°F (16.2°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November67.6°F (19.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December70.3°F (21.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

How can I get to Royal Botanic Gardens?
With so many choices for transportation, seeing all of the area near Royal Botanic Gardens is easy. You can access metro transit at Martin Place Station, St. James Station, and Wynyard Station. To venture out into the surrounding area, hop aboard a train at Sydney Circular Quay Station or Exhibition Centre Station. You can learn about your options for water transportation at the local port.
